Krebs-Henseleit buffer was developed in the early

1930's by Hans Krebs and Kurt Henseleit. This

modification of Ringer's solution was used to maintain

liver tissue during experiments that led Krebs to

postulate the urea cycle. The formula offered by

Sigma has been modified by the addition of 2 g/L of

glucose as an energy source for cell maintenance, and

by the omission of calcium chloride.
